The New York Giants (2-1) host the Chicago Bears (2-1) in an NFC matchup on Sunday at MetLife Stadium. The Giants are coming off a 23-16 loss to the Dallas Cowboys on Monday Night Football, while the Bears beat the Houston Texans 23-20 on a game-winning field goal from Cairo Santos. The Bears lead the all-time series 36-24-2, and have won three straight matchups against the Giants. New York is 2-1, while Chicago is 1-1-1 against the spread in 2022.

What you need to know about the Giants

The Giants came up short against the Dallas Cowboys this past Monday, falling 23-16. RB Saquon Barkley put forth a good effort for the losing side as he punched in one rushing touchdown. The loss to the Cowboys dropped the Giants to 2-1 on the season.
